分子排阻色谱法测定头孢氨苄聚合物 被引量:4

Determination of Polymers in Cefalexin by Molecular-exclusion Chromatographic

摘要 目的建立用分子排阻色谱法分析头孢氨苄聚合物的方法。方法色谱柱:Sephadex G-10色谱柱(15.0mm×300mm,40~120μm);流动相A:pH8.0的0.2mo1/L磷酸盐缓冲液[0.2mo1/L磷酸氢二钠溶液-0.2mo1/L磷酸二氢钠溶液(95:5)];流动相B:超纯水;检测波长:254nm;流速:1.5mL/min。以头孢拉定作对照加校正因子外标法定量(头孢氨苄:头孢拉定=1:1)。结果头孢氨苄聚合物在1~20μg/mL范围内呈良好的线形关系(r=0.9992)。结论方法简便易行,能较好的分离头孢氨苄与其聚合物,且精密度、准确度均能满足质量控制的要求。 Objective To establish a method for the determination of polymer in cefalexin by molecular- exclusion chromatographic. Methods The analytical column was Sephadex G-10(15.0mm×300mm, 40-120μm); the mobile phase A was 0.2 mol/L phosphate buffer(pH8.0); the mobile phase B was water; the detection wavelength was set at 254nm; the flow rate was 1.5 mL/min. The concentration of polymers was quantified by external standard method of cefradine with a correct factor (cefalexin:cefradine=l:l) . Results The calibration cure of the polymers was linear within concentration range of l-20μg/mL (r=0.9992) . Conclusion The method was convenient and accurate. The method is promising for the separation of polymers, and the accuracy and precision are suitable for the drug quality contol.
